    To the best of my knowledge, if you want to fish from a boat you must rent. Electric motors only and the fishing will be catch and release only at least through 2011. For more info, try  www.NWHerald.com   or the City of Crystal Lake web site. Three Oakes Red area is not part of the CL park district but is a city owned property. Tom

    I had one more piece of information come to light this morning. Seems that the only live bait permitted at Three Oaks is worms purchased on site. No bringing in your own bait! Also, turns out that ice fishing will not be permitted. Tom

    I was told they will increase to $10 parking fees. If anyone plans to go there, BYOB! (Bring your own bait) Worms there are around $4! And you need to stay on the paths next season. The police are going to start cracking down on people for people going off the paths next season. To many people go there. As a fisherman, you will need to rent one of there boats if you are seroius. If you fish the shore you will have kids throwing rocks in the water or something other thing that people do to scare the fish. They got nice pike and bass. I got 13 pounds of bass in 3 hours. It costly to fish but its a great place to take your kids or girlfriend.
